之所以本文標題是叫初步制作,是因為我覺得模板的制作與修改應該是基于大量的現有數據研究而得出的,但是一個網站上線,你必須要設計出一個初始模板才能獲取數據,而初始模板的設計也是有技巧的,若是我們模板過于糟糕,則需要我們修正數次才有可能得到最終的數據結果,這顯然對網站是不利的。
那么我們如何制作初始模板?
1.制作草圖。
在制作草圖時,我們要考慮以下幾個方面:
?競爭對手的網站設計。這里所說的競爭對手,是指你主關鍵詞自然排名前三的站點,在這里你要注意這么幾個方面:
a.對手的頁面布局。這個應該是你在設計第一套模板時耗時長的步驟,任何一個優(yōu)化站其訪問縱深和跳出率都是優(yōu)化人員格外關心的數據,既然你的前輩們如此布局網站,那可能有一定的道理在里面,比如其輪展的圖片的選擇、首頁調用欄目的選擇、首頁設計與其目標關鍵詞的相關性等,找出設置它們的理由,然后根據自身情況來制定首頁布局。
b.首頁打開的速度。若對方打開很快,那你至少要和其速度持平,但倘若對方打開較慢,則你的速度必須快過他。
c.分析你用戶的實際需求與潛在需求。實際需求由何而來,來自于入站的關鍵詞,比如你用戶搜索的是“天津人流多少錢”這個詞,那么其實際需求是想知道價格,但是其潛在需求是想在天津地區(qū)做人流,則無痛、安全等諸多因素可能是影響其最終轉化的重要環(huán)節(jié),這時候你就要依托于模板,利用不同的位置將用戶進行細分,進行精心的轉化。這方面,可以參考那些做得好的競爭對手。
②優(yōu)化制作草圖時的細節(jié)。設計僅僅是一個方面,將設計由代碼實現的時候,就由很多seo因素要優(yōu)化了。
a.重要文字的css控制。一些重要文字,可以用h2或h3標簽,不必擔心h1標簽會引起不美觀,因為你完全可以通過css來控制你文字的展現。但要注意,切記不可多用,太多重點等于沒重點。
b.圖片web化,縮小大小。這沒什么好說的。
c.無意義的錨文字,例如“更多”,“點擊了解詳情”等,改用圖片鏈。
d.細節(jié)代碼要補全,例如為img標簽添加alt屬性等。
e.避免文字截斷。有時候一些開源程序中調用的錨文本若是文字太長,會被自動截斷(例如織夢CMS),我們要編寫css,將溢出的文字由“....”替代顯示,但是html代碼中依舊存在。
2.優(yōu)化模板速度。
說道優(yōu)化模板速度,我就需要先說一下瀏覽器的工作原理。
瀏覽器是如何工作的呢?簡單來說,其工作原理很簡單,用戶在瀏覽器中提供一個URL,比如“http://www.letians.cn/231.html”,則瀏覽器會將這段URL拆分為三部分。
然后將域名發(fā)給DNS解析,當解析成功后,再將文件名發(fā)給服務器,由服務器提取文件返回給瀏覽器,瀏覽器將文件解析展示給用戶。而這里要注明一點,就是當我們訪問網站首頁的時候,瀏覽器會自動將最后那個“/”過濾掉。
在此展開說一下,很多人問我做外鏈的時候,首頁加不加那個“/”有區(qū)別嗎,我想通過上述講解大家就應該明白了,是有區(qū)別的,但是隨著搜素引擎的發(fā)展,我感覺影響不大,但是還是建議大家做的時候統(tǒng)一一下,要么就都加,要么就都不加。
那么瀏覽器接收到文件開始處理的時候,主要是5大組件進行工作,這5大組件分別是:
用戶界面:我們平時看到的界面。
渲染引擎:負責解析文件源碼。
核心引擎:將渲染引擎與端口相結合的接口。
JS解析器:解析JS代碼。
數據存儲:存儲一些臨時文件,例如cookie。
這里要說一下,上述是功能性的組件,并非是瀏覽器的構成,不同的瀏覽器內核實現這些功能的方法不同。這5個部分只是對瀏覽器很膚淺、很模糊的概念性了解。
那么我們在模板中,要盡量如何操作呢?
a.減少請求路徑,凡是有一個路徑,我們的瀏覽器的就會多一次向服務器發(fā)送一次請求,如果在網頁中把多次使用的css、js等統(tǒng)一的放在的head,就需要一次請求。
b.減少JS代碼。JS代碼盡可能放在標簽內。
c.盡可能減少文件大小。
通過上述步驟,基本上初始的模板就已經制作完成了,剩下的就是在網站的運營過程中監(jiān)控用戶的聚焦點以及站內流量,來根據數據來具體的優(yōu)化用戶體驗了。
我們專注高端建站,小程序開發(fā)、軟件系統(tǒng)定制開發(fā)、BUG修復、物聯網開發(fā)、各類API接口對接開發(fā)等。十余年開發(fā)經驗,每一個項目承諾做到滿意為止,多一次對比,一定讓您多一份收獲!